DENVER–(BUSINESS WIRE)–From new consumer buying patterns to dramatically higher costs for fuel and labor, truckload freight professionals faced fresh challenges in 2022 that have led to a more measured, data-driven approach to 2023, according to a new annual report published by DAT Freight & Analytics.

Crews working on the Port Rail Shuttle Network (PRSN) project have completed laying the track of a new rail connection that enables more efficient transportation of freight from Dandenong South to the Port of Melbourne. .
